What is MRI and MRA of Peripheral?
MRI and MRA of the peripheral vessels is a combined imaging procedure used to assess both the soft tissues and blood vessels in the limbs (arms and legs). MRI (Magnetic Resonance Imaging) provides detailed images of the muscles, joints, tendons, and bones, helping to diagnose conditions like injuries, inflammation, or tumors.
MRA (Magnetic Resonance Angiography) focuses specifically on the blood vessels, such as the arteries in the legs or arms, to detect blockages, aneurysms, or vascular diseases like peripheral artery disease (PAD). During the procedure, you will lie still in an MRI scanner, and a contrast dye may be injected to enhance image clarity.
Fasting is typically not required, but it may be necessary if contrast is used. Risks include allergic reactions to contrast dye and mild discomfort from staying still.
This combination provides a comprehensive view of both structural and vascular health in the limbs.
